Detailed Loan Comparison Table
| Loan App | Loan Amount | Repayment Tenure | Best For | Key Benefits |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Moneyview | Up to ₹10 Lakh | Up to 60 Months | Salaried & Self-employed | Quick approval, instant disbursal, flexible EMIs |
| KreditBee | Up to ₹5 Lakh | Flexible | Young Professionals | Fast approval, paperless process |
| Kist | Based on Eligibility | Flexible | Instant Personal Loans | Simple online application and quick processing |
| Ring | Credit Limit Based | Flexible | Credit Line Users | Digital credit line with easy repayments |
| MyMoney | Varies by Lender | Flexible | Everyday Financial Needs | Quick online application and minimal documentation |
| Paytm Postpaid | Credit Limit Based | Monthly Billing Cycle | Small Daily Expenses | Buy now, pay later for eligible users |
| Dhani | Based on Eligibility | Flexible | Medical & Personal Expenses | Instant loan approval and digital services |
Note: Loan amount, repayment tenure, interest rate, and approval depend on the lender’s policy, applicant’s income, credit score, and eligibility. Therefore, always verify the latest information on the official website before applying.

Eligibility Criteria
Before applying for a Personal Loan, applicants should carefully check the lender’s eligibility requirements. Although the criteria vary from one lender to another, most digital loan apps follow similar standards. Generally, applicants must be Indian citizens with a regular source of income. Moreover, they should have valid KYC documents and an active bank account. Additionally, maintaining a good credit score can improve the chances of approval. Therefore, reviewing the eligibility conditions in advance can save time and reduce the chances of rejection.
Most digital lenders require:
- Indian Citizen
- Age between 21–58 years
- Regular source of income
- Aadhaar Card
- PAN Card
- Active bank account
- Mobile number linked with Aadhaar

Common Reasons Why Personal Loan Applications Get Rejected
A Personal Loan application may be rejected for several reasons. Therefore, understanding these factors can significantly improve your chances of approval. Moreover, lenders carefully evaluate your credit score, monthly income, employment status, existing loan obligations, and repayment history before making a decision. Additionally, submitting incorrect information or incomplete documents may also lead to rejection. However, if you meet the eligibility criteria and provide accurate details, your approval chances can improve. Finally, maintaining a good credit profile and applying responsibly can help you secure a Personal Loan more easily in the future.
- Low credit score or poor repayment history.
- Incorrect or incomplete KYC documents.
- Insufficient monthly income.
- Existing high loan or credit card burden.
- Frequent loan applications in a short period.
- Mismatch in bank or employment details.

RBI-Regulated Lenders vs Fake Loan Apps
Many borrowers cannot distinguish between genuine digital lenders and fraudulent loan applications. Therefore, understanding the difference is essential before applying for any personal loan.
| RBI-Regulated Lenders | Fake Loan Apps |
|---|---|
| Work with regulated financial institutions or lending partners. | Often hide lender details. |
| Clearly disclose interest rates and charges. | Frequently hide or misrepresent fees. |
| Follow KYC and lending regulations. | May ask for unnecessary permissions or personal data. |
| Provide proper customer support. | Customer support is often unavailable or unreliable. |
| Issue legally valid loan agreements. | Terms and conditions are often unclear. |
Important: Before applying, verify that the loan is offered by a regulated bank or NBFC and carefully review the lender details provided within the app.
